LMV324ID Overview
The product is packaged in a 14-SOIC case with a width of 0.154 inches (3.90mm). It complies with the JESD-609 code e4, indicating its reliability and quality standards. The product is currently active and available for purchase. It has a pin count of 14, allowing for various connections. The output type is rail-to-rail, providing a wide dynamic range. The operating supply current is 410μA, ensuring efficient power consumption. The unity gain BW-Nom is 1000 kHz, indicating its ability to handle high-frequency signals. The product does not have a low-offset or low-bias feature. Its thickness is 1.58mm, making it compact and suitable for space-constrained applications.
